a quick question what does dsplle stand for?


RE: DSPLLE - KHRZ - 07-29-2009

DSP is the audio decoder chip of the GC/Wii. LLE stands for low level emulation, meaning it's being emulated closer to the real thing using some files you need to dump from your GC/Wii, Anyway it's much slower, there's no public tool for extracting it and the HLE (high level emulation) works much better anyway.
